LTM-10A Platform and Gizmo 4 I/O Board

1. Declare the I/O hardware for the Switch following these steps:

a. Double-click the Switch.h file in the Project pane to edit the source file.

b. Find the following line of code near the end of the Editor window:

//}}NodeBuilder Code Wizard End

c. Add the following line of code after the line referenced in step b.

IO_6 input bit ioSwitch1;

2. Add functionality to the Switch I/O following these steps:

a. Double-click the Switch.nc file in the Project pane.

b. Find the following line of code at the end of the Editor window:

#endif // _Switch_NC_

c. Add the following when clause before the line referenced in step b:

when(io_changes(ioSwitch1))
{

nvoSwitch.state = !input_value;

nvoSwitch.value = input_value ? 200u : 0;

}

3. Declare the I/O hardware for the LED. To do this follow these steps:

a. Double-click the LED.h file in the Project pane.

b. Find the following line of code near the end of the Editor window:

//}}NodeBuilder Code Wizard End

c. Add the following line of code after the line referenced in step b.

IO_0 output bit ioLamp = 1;

4. Add functionality to the LED I/O following these steps:

a. Double-click the LED.nc file in the Project pane.

b. Find the following lines of code near the beginning of the Editor window:

when(nv_update_occurs(nviValue))


//
//}}NodeBuilder Code Wizard End
{

c. Add the following line of code after the lines referenced in step b:

io_out(ioLamp, !(nviLamp.value && nviLamp.state));

5. Click File and then click Save All to save all your changes to the source files.

6. Proceed to the next section to compile your Neuron C application, and then build an application

image and download it to your device.
